Output 3d77903a4228069859292a5538d16d4b1f29a0e4210431b22ba4dcf16cd98539:2

value
413440
script pubkey
OP_0 OP_PUSHBYTES_20 588ed546463c18a5602d1ed9969758ee0a1f183d
address
bc1qtz8d23jx8sv22cpdrmved96cac9p7xpa8p9cqz
transaction
3d77903a4228069859292a5538d16d4b1f29a0e4210431b22ba4dcf16cd98539
spent
true